工程师之路:解决 Android Studio 中“没有 Android SDK”的问题
作为一名经验丰富的开发者,看到许多初学者在使用 Android Studio 时遭遇的困难,我们非常有必要教学相长,帮助他们顺利进入 Android 开发的世界。其中一个常见的问题是“Android Studio 没有 Android SDK”。本文将逐步引导你解决这个问题,以及如何正确配置 SDK。
问题流程
下面是解决“没有 Android SDK”问题的简要流程:
步骤 | 操作 |
---|---|
1 | 下载并安装 Android Studio |
2 | 确认 SDK 是否已经下载 |
3 | 如果没有,则及时下载 Android SDK |
4 | 配置 Android Studio 的 SDK 路径 |
5 | 重启 Android Studio |
每一步详细讲解
1. 下载并安装 Android Studio
首先,你需要确保你的计算机上已经安装了 Android Studio。可以在[Android Studio 官网](
2. 确认 SDK 是否已经下载
安装完成后,启动 Android Studio。如果系统提示没有找到 SDK,你可以在菜单中找到 SDK 管理器以检查 SDK 状态。
3. 如果没有,则及时下载 Android SDK
如果你发现 SDK 并没有下载,步骤如下:
- 启动 Android Studio。
- 在欢迎界面中选择“Configure” -> “SDK Manager”。
代码示例(此步骤无需代码,仅需操作)
-
选择新的 SDK 版本,并点击“Apply”。
![SDK 管理界面](
4. 配置 Android Studio 的 SDK 路径
配置 Android SDK 的路径,确保 Android Studio 能够找到 SDK。
- 首先,打开 SDK 管理器。
- 点击“Android SDK Location”查看并记录 SDK 路径。
如果没有被自动检测到,可以手动输入。
// 手动设置 Android SDK 的路径
// 这里的路径是示例,请根据实际路径修改
val sdkPath: String = "/Users/username/Library/Android/sdk" // SDK安装路径
5. 重启 Android Studio
完成上述步骤后,重启 Android Studio,确保更改生效。
类图与关系图展示
在 Android 开发中,组件之间的关系和结构是极其重要的。下面是基于 Android 应用中模块的简单类图:
classDiagram
class MainActivity {
+ onCreate()
+ startActivity()
}
class User {
+ login()
+ logout()
}
class Database {
+ saveData()
+ getData()
}
MainActivity --> User : manage
MainActivity --> Database : interact
接下来是实体关系图 (ER图),展示了与用户和数据库的关系。
erDiagram
USER {
string name
string email
string password
}
DATABASE {
string id
string data
}
USER ||--o{ DATABASE : stores
结尾
总之,解决“Android Studio 没有 Android SDK”的问题并不复杂。而是通过几个简洁的步骤,便能解决该问题并顺利开始你的 Android 开发之旅。希望通过本文的详细介绍,每位初学者都能掌握 SDK 配置的方法及其他基本操作,为以后的开发打下坚实的基础。如果遇到任何其他问题,随时欢迎向我咨询。祝你在 Android 开发上大展宏图!